Tool Creation for Matimo SDK
This skill teaches you how to properly create, configure, and validate tools for the Matimo SDK—a configuration-driven framework where tools are defined once in YAML and executed everywhere (factory pattern, decorators, LangChain).
Two audiences — know which one you are:
You are an Agent at runtime You are an SDK developer Creating tools dynamically via matimo_create_toolAdding tools to the SDK codebase Tools go to ./matimo-tools/{tool-name}/definition.yaml(configured by developer)Tools go to packages/{provider}/tools/{tool-name}/definition.yamlValidate with matimo_doctor(meta-tool)Validate with pnpm validate-tools(CLI)Approval needed: matimo_approve_tool→matimo_reload_toolsNo approval flow — merged via git If you are an agent using meta-tools, follow the "Agent at runtime" column throughout this skill.
Matimo Architecture Overview
Tool Execution Flow
Tool Definition (YAML)
↓
ToolLoader (parse & validate)
↓
ToolRegistry (in-memory store)
↓
MatimoInstance.execute(name, params)
↓
Select Executor Based on execution.type
↓
CommandExecutor | HttpExecutor | FunctionExecutor
↓
Validate output against output_schema
↓
Return structured result
Key Concepts
- Tools are YAML-first: Define once in YAML, execute anywhere
- Always include
requires_approval: true: Required by policy for all agent-created tools - Default execution type is
http:commandandfunctiontypes are blocked by policy by default — only usehttpunless the developer has explicitly enabled the others - Parameter templating: Use
{paramName}syntax for dynamic values - Authentication: Provider-agnostic (API key, bearer, basic, OAuth2)
- Output validation: All responses validated against Zod schemas
- Error handling: Structured errors with retry/backoff policies
